Jennifer McMurrayJennifer McMurray

I was born in August of 1952 in Columbus, Ohio. Therefore I am a Buckeye at heart and true football fan of The Ohio State University. I received a diploma in nursing Riverside White Cross School of Nursing. I worked in pediatrics at Riverside Methodist Hospital in Columbus until I married a Navy man and began by trek across the eastern United States, eventually settling in Norfolk.

While in Norfolk I worked as a Nurse Practitioner in the Neonatal Intensive Care Unit at CHKD for 15 years and continued my education. I earned a Neonatal Nurse Practitioner certificate from Georgetown University; received a bachelors of science in Nursing from the University of New York; a Masters in Perinatal Nursing from Old Dominion University; a post-graduate certificate as a Pediatric Nurse Practitioner from Old Dominion and Norfolk State University; and my Doctorate of Nursing Practice from Old Dominion University (in 2010). I served as the coordinator for the Eastern Virginia Perinatal Council and provided educational offerings to outlying hospitals concerning care of premature infants.

I joined Renaissance Pediatrics in 1998 and became a partner in 2003. I am a proud volunteer for the March of Dimes and serve as the Program Service Chair for the Greater Hampton Roads Chapter. In 2011 I became the State Prematurity Chair for the March of Dimes.

I now live in Suffolk and have one son, Trevor McMurray, and five grandchildren. I enjoy spending as much time as possible with them. In my spare time I enjoy church activities, reading, scrapbooking, and crafts of all kinds.

My greatest love is children and I am dedicated to the health and well being of all children.
